Shape the Future of Sustainable and Circular Buildings – NEB Prizes 2026 Open for Applications

5 Mar 2026

The New European Bauhaus (NEB) Prizes 2026 are now open for applications, offering a fantastic opportunity to showcase innovative, sustainable, and circular solutions in the built environment. This initiative, led by the European Commission, celebrates projects that combine design, sustainability, and inclusivity to transform how we live, work, and interact with our surroundings.

One of the four main prize categories, Enhancing Circularity, Sustainability, and Innovation”, specifically recognizes initiatives that improve resource efficiency, circular design, and eco-friendly solutions in buildings, neighborhoods, and public spaces. This makes it a perfect fit for organizations, municipalities, and innovators aligned with the Shake Up mission of driving sustainability and circularity in construction and urban spaces.

The competition welcomes both completed projects (Champions – Strand A) and concepts by young innovators (Rising Stars – Strand B). Winners will gain visibility, networking opportunities, and support to scale their ideas, contributing to the NEB vision of a greener, more inclusive, and beautiful Europe.

Deadline: 17 March 2026
